Nosy Be, like a local
Don't miss
- Nosy Tanikely Marine Reserve: Stunning snorkeling and diving opportunities in a protected marine area.
- Lokobe National Park: Home to unique wildlife and lush rainforest, perfect for hiking.
- Mont Passot: Offers breathtaking panoramic views, especially at sunset.
- Hell-Ville: The main town with vibrant markets and local culture.
- Ankify Beach: A quieter beach with stunning views and less tourist traffic.
Where to eat
- Chez Fred: Known for its fresh seafood and authentic Malagasy dishes.
- La Table de la Baie: Offers a fusion of local and international cuisine with a beautiful view.
- Snack La Mer: A local favorite for inexpensive and delicious street food.
Do this
- Ylang-Ylang Distillery Tour: Experience the aromatic process of essential oil extraction.
- Traditional Malagasy Dance Show: Immerse yourself in the local culture through music and dance.
- Island Hopping Excursion: Explore the nearby islands and enjoy pristine beaches and snorkeling.
Local tips
- Bring cash for local markets and smaller establishments as many don’t accept cards.
- Try the local rum, 'Rhum Arrangé', which is a popular homemade drink.
- Visit the local markets in Hell-Ville for fresh produce and artisanal goods, especially on weekends.
- Engage with local fishermen for a chance to join them on their daily catch – it's a unique experience!
Know before you go
Best time
Apr-Jun, Sep-Oct. These months offer the best weather, with warm temperatures and minimal rainfall, making it ideal for beach activities and exploring the island.
Getting around
Taxis and tuk-tuks are the most common means of transport. Rental scooters and bicycles are also popular for exploring the island.
Airport
NOS
Language
Malagasy and French are the primary languages spoken.
Money
The local currency is Malagasy Ariary (MGA). Credit cards are accepted at some hotels and restaurants, but cash is preferred for local transactions.
Safety
Nosy Be is generally safe for tourists, but it's wise to take standard precautions such as avoiding isolated areas at night and securing valuables.
